The Jailer`s Cottage: Historic Charm on Over an Acre

Welcome to our enchanting turn-of-the-century home in the quiet, quaint town of Spring City. Sitting on over an acre next to the 165-year-old rock jailhouse (still intact!), this unique 130-year-old cottage offers authentic charm and modern comfort for your Central Utah getaway.

About the Bathroom:

For over 60 years, large families used the existing outhouse and wash tub. A pink bathtub was added around 1950, followed by a toilet and small sink a few years later. Today, you get to experience this piece of history as it has been for the past 70+ years - a charming reminder of simpler times.
